For as long as I can remember, I’ve been a dreamer. There are dreams that I had as a little girl that I still carry with me to this day. Dreams that over 30 years later, I can remember as vividly as the night I dreamt them. Dreams I’d wake up from in the middle of the night knowing they had to have a greater meaning, though I didn’t know exactly what that meaning was. It was this undercurrent of curiosity that finally drove me to seek out the origin, the meaning, and ultimately, the interpretation of our dreams.

What happens at night when we sleep? Why do we wake up with such a sense of urgency to find the meaning of some dreams, while others seem to disappear from our memory, like vanishing ink, only moments after we open our eyes? Do dreams really have a significant meaning? Does God use dreams to communicate with us today? What do all the various colors, symbols, numbers, and pictures mean? How about the dreams that keep coming back, time and time again?

In the few years I’ve been studying biblical dream interpretation, I’ve learned a lot, and I’ve committed myself to an ongoing journey of learning. But what I’ve discovered so far has changed my life. And because of what I’ve come to know as true – that God really does want to communicate with us in our dreams – it has become a passion of mine, not only to help people interpret what God is saying, but to help teach the language of dream interpretation to others, so that we can all do this for ourselves, and teach our children and the generations to come to do the same.

Wherever you are in this journey, I pray that above all, a greater hunger will awaken within your heart to become more aware of your dreams, to value and capture them, and to pursue God for the answers and the meaning. He is a good Father who is very active and involved in every detail of our lives. He knows where we’re at and where we’re going, and He desperately wants to communicate His heart to us, making Himself known and speaking to us through dreams and visions.

Every dream is an invitation to a intimate conversation, where we get to tune in to what heaven is saying, and if we will simply respond, our lives will forever be changed.
